Oakridge Centre Fall Fashion Show
September 16; from $25; Oakridge Centre; 650 West 41st Ave., Vancouver, 604-261-2511; oakridgecentre.com.
Calling all stylistas! Channel your inner fashion editor and treat yourself to a seat at Oakridge’s annual fall show. ETalk’s Susie Wall hosts a parade of highlights from the collections of designers Michael Kors, MaxMara, Hugo Boss and more. It must be a year of anniversaries: besides Blo Blow Dry Bar turning one year old, 2008 is the 20th anniversary of not one, but three fashion editors: Anna Wintour (of Vogue, duh), Franca Sozzani (of Italian Vogue) and Suzy Menkes (of tall hair fame and the International Herald Tribune). Closer to home, it’s also the 30th birthday of Banana Republic (bananarepublic.com).
